In 2019, Pennsville, Salem County, reported 36 drug overdose cases, marking a significant community health concern.
Pennsville, Salem County, saw a 15% increase in drug-related arrests between 2018 and 2020.
Salem County, including Pennsville, had over 200 naloxone deployments in 2020, reflecting the opioid crisis impact.
In Pennsville, reports indicated a 25% rise in opioid-related emergency room visits from 2017 to 2021.
The area surrounding Pennsville in Salem County documented a 20% decline in youth drug use from 2015 to 2020.
Pennsville, Salem County observed a reduction in drug-induced death rates by 10% between 2019 and 2021 due to intervention efforts.
In Pennsville, NJ, many employers implement strict drug testing policies to ensure a safe and productive working environment. These policies are crucial for workplaces concentrating in industries demanding heightened attention to safety and regulations. Companies typically adhere to state guidelines provided by the U.S. Department of Labor in implementing drug testing procedures.
Drug testing in Pennsville is usually conducted during the hiring process and may also include random tests during employment. Employers aim to maintain workplace integrity and safety, reducing the risk associated with substance abuse. Adhering to guidelines like those from the Drug-Free Workplace Act has become standard practice in Pennsville, NJ.
The government of Pennsville, NJ, has embarked on several initiatives to address the growing drug problem within Salem County. These efforts include increased funding for local rehabilitation centers and public awareness campaigns aimed at reducing the stigma associated with addiction. The New Jersey Division of Mental Health and Addiction Services provides resources and support to tackle these issues effectively.
Local law enforcement in Pennsville collaborates with state agencies to conduct educational programs in schools and communities, emphasizing prevention and early intervention. A collaborative approach with the NJ CARES initiative ensures that data-driven strategies are employed to curb the opioid epidemic that affects Salem County and beyond.
